Machine Learning Perception
Machine Learning Perception is a subfield of artificial intelligence that focuses on enabling machines to interpret and understand sensory data from the world, such as images, audio, and video, using machine learning algorithms. It involves tasks like object detection, speech recognition, and scene understanding, allowing systems to perceive their environment similarly to humans. This technology is foundational for applications like autonomous vehicles, facial recognition, and voice assistants.
